  • Miniphone Ultra

    How cool is this? A simple 3D‑printed case that turns your Apple Watch Ultra into a tiny phone. It doesn’t add much – just a bit of plastic so you can actually hold it – but that small tweak unlocks a perfect minimal phone: no buzzing on your wrist, no doom‑scrolling; just the essentials. Honestly, it's kind of perfect. (Ok, well, it's not perfect that it doesn't exist for my – admittedly dated – Apple Watch 6, but still! Maybe there will be a version for it someday!)

  • Where are all the AI games?

    From Why No AI Games?: I think what’s really going on here is that these new models just aren’t the natural source of fun I thought they would be when I first encountered them. Some forms of computation end up being a deep well of fun. 3D rendering is fun. Physics engines are fun. But these new AI models, despite being powerful and useful and fascinating, don’t seem to be intrinsically fun.
